Outreach Phlebotomist
The Outreach phlebotomist is responsible for collecting blood specimens on all age groups and preparing specimens for transport to testing lab (s). This is a fast-paced, customer-focused environment with high patient volume. The ability to work independently and efficiently is essential. Self-motivated with excellent customer service skills are a must. An eye for detail and a high degree of accuracy in interpreting physician orders is crucial. Other duties include answering the phone and responding to patient/MD requests for lab results, fasting requirements and hours of operation. Must have reliable transportation and be willing to travel around the service area – Monmouth and Ocean counties. Must be comfortable working alone. Must be willing to drive in bad weather – Outreach operations do not stop during inclement weather
